Helping every owner establish trust, build a relationship and find what motivates the dog are always top priorities for us. As a dog trainer, we are well versed in all training tools so we can help out as much as possible. Millions of dogs every year are given up or euthanized due to behavior problems (some as simple as jumping) we won't discriminate against any method or tool that is in the best interest for the owner and dog. We believe every tool can be used properly or improperly.

For example, people can feed their dogs too much food or lousy food causing illness or obesity. Or, food and praise can over stimulate some dogs causing hyperactivity, jumping, whining, barking, etc. Another example that we've seen as dog trainers is that dogs can become addicted to attention when coddled and fussed over too much which can cause separation anxiety. In conclusion, we believe knowledge is power and being openminded allows us to help as much as possible.

We believe in transforming dog owners into fair and consistent leaders who can provide the right amount of balance,structure, exercise, nutrition and obedience to create much happier, calmer and more fulfilled dogs. Faster training is not better training, as dog trainers, we teach first, so the dog has a good understanding of what we want them to do before focusing on making the behavior reliable. When trying to achieve learning and reliability all at once, it is way too stressful on our dogs.

If our dogs do not understand something, we've taught it is our job as the dog trainer to go back and increase the dogs understanding. Patience is incredibly important in dog training. You have to know when to take a step back or stop altogether. No good dog training happens when you are frustrated. We believe in being as transparent as possible. We will always tell you what weare doing and why we are doing it. Anything we do as trainers will always be approved and agreed upon by the owners first.

We will always give our opinions, but we won't do anything you are uncomfortable with. Think with your head, not with your heart. Treating dogs like furry little people have created more problems than it has ever solved. We know you love them, but sometimes despoiling our dogs is hard and sometimes a little tough love is the best love. It is our responsibility as trainers to be as clear and as easy to understand as possible.

We try to be just as good at teaching people as we are at teaching dogs We will always keep learning and striving to be the best that we can be.
